| | Olympic fashion don'tsFebruary 19, 2010 - Deb GauI've been trying to watch some of the winter Olympics when I can. So far, it seems like the only events they've been showing when I'm able to watch have been snowboarding. No real complaints there — any sport that involves aerial backflips is fun to watch. But I still have to pause and think, "The heck are they wearing?!?" I knew snowboarding was popularized by young people who tend to wear baggy clothing, but I was surprised to learn that having your pants hanging off your butt is actually part of the standard snowboarding uniform, even for women. It didn't matter if the competitors were from Japan or France, they were all wearing low-riders under their parkas. And of course, the parkas themselves came in grunge-tastic plaid for the American team. Totally extreme, dude. Speaking of pants, I'm disappointed that I missed coverage of this year's Olympic curling round-robins. Apparently, the Norwegian team is kitted out in red-and-white argyle golf pants. The pictures are all over the media, but there'd be nothing like the surprise of seeing that team walking out onto the ice for the first time. Article CommentsNo comments posted for this article.
